Mr. Speaker, I appreciate my friend from Tennessee (Mr. Rose) in leading this effort tonight and for all his great work on our messaging that we are doing as a Republican Conference to illustrate to the people of the country what it is we are trying to do and that is our belief that it will be good for America and, in this case with the NDAA, good for our military and the people who populate it. Regarding this NDAA, the point I want to make this round is that the NDAA puts real muscle behind countering China's aggression with $15.6 billion for the Pacific deterrence initiative, which is about $5.7 billion more than what the Biden administration thought was going to be adequate. We are covering gaps the administration ignored, funding $490 million toward critical Indo-Pacific command priorities to shore up operations and capabilities in the region. We are making it clear: Taiwan won't have to stand alone. This bill launches the Taiwan security cooperation initiative to send lethal aid where it is needed most.
